Considerations on Negativ Body Image-Project
Negativ Body Image as provisional working title describes the totality of bodily psychologicalAppearcance, visible externally characteristics, as well as attitudes and behaviorswhich are status- und socializationrelated.
The possible results are negativ self-attribution („I cannot do that“) or foreign attribution„you do not belong to…“, stigmatization and exclusion, subsequently my arisefall back, refusal, refuge in drugs, aggression and hatred against others and selfinjury.
Bodily and other characteristics which are not konform with the consumerist norm,are seen as negativ.
The causes can be rewritten als follows:- societiy- pathological, illness- wrong nutrition
- lack of individual promotion, resignation- lack of energie for learning, motion and efforts- systematic failure of family, school and vocational training

Example: Organization of social work and counseling in one of the vocational traning schools in Berlin:
Social worker:(Full-time) Support coping of actuel and futur critical
life stages, mediation, contacts to „Jugendamt“, occupationa guidance
Contact teacher:investigated prophylaxis: Counceling in cases of drug conflicts an abuse,
selection of alternative offered
2 Switching teachers: mediation of school conflicts
Consulting teachers: Advice in conflicts in crises, supporting in cases of problems
of learning and performance trouble
